All you have to do is you have both mechanisms complete is the let the motor
wind down and move the 50 spring barrels over to the 30 and the 30 to the 50.
You will have to move the hook that holds the spring as the extra barrel is in
the way, see below for more info. If you drop the complete 50 mechanism in a 30
you will need to relocate the hook holding the spring that goes from the horn
to the motorboard. Most boards are drilled universal so you can do this with
no problem and you can make a 30 a double spring motor if you put the springs
barrels from a 50 on the 30 board. Make sure the rubber hose that covers the
lug is there to insulate against motor noise. I repaired a 30 with a broken
motor board by placing a 50 mechanism in it, you will want to change the ID
plate as well, I think I still have brass nails for the ID plate transfer. Steve

> I have heard in the past that one can take an Edison Amberola 50 mechanism
> and drop it in an Amberola 30 case with no problem, and have a machine (sort
> of a hotrod" which has the attributes' of the longer playing 50 in a smaller
> case. Is this so?
>
>
>
> What modifications if any, is needed to do this? Discussion regarding this
> matter would be appreciated.
